Abstract
An orthopedic simulator including a holder assembly and a slide table is disclosed. The holder assembly is configured to hold a test specimen to supply test loads. In the embodiment shown, the slide table is coupled to the holder assembly and includes a plurality of translation plates movable along a plurality of axis. As shown, the plurality of translation plates include a first translation plate movable along a first axis and a second translation plate movable along a second axis generally transverse to the first axis. In illustrated embodiments, an adjustable screw lock is configured to provide a positive lock to restrict movement or stroke of the first or second translation plates along the first or second axis. As disclosed, movement of the first or second translation plates is biased via a spring assembly for example to simulate the effect of soft tissue.

16. A simulator assembly comprising:
-
a base; a holder assembly configured to hold a test specimen; a first translation plate coupled to the base through a first linear slide and rail arrangement and movable along a first axis; a second translation plate coupled to the first translation plate through a second linear slide and rail arrangement and movable along a second axis, different from the first axis; at least one post coupled to the base; at least one upright portion coupled to the first translation plate; a first spring assembly configured to input a first biasing force to the first translation plate and the first spring assembly includes a spring between the at least one post and the first translation plate to input the first biasing force; and a second spring assembly configured to input a second biasing force to the second translation plate and the second spring assembly includes a spring between the at least one upright portion and the second translation plate to input second the biasing force. - View Dependent Claims (17, 18, 19, 20, 21, 22, 23)
